Job description

Department

The University of York Library is seeking an exceptional candidate to join our Content & Open Research and Customer Services teams. The Content & Open Research team is responsible for the acquisition and ongoing management of information resources and library collections, and for supporting researchers to make their research outputs as visible andopenly available as possible.

The Customer Services team is responsible for the daily operational delivery of the Library’s core frontline services, and our Help Desk offers support in person and virtually for library and IT queries. The Library’s core values of customer focus, collaboration and continuous improvement are central to our supportive and empowering working culture, and we take great pride in the high quality services we deliver to our user communities.

Role

We have 1 full time Information Assistant role split between Content & Open Research and Customer Services available.

As Information Assistants, you will participate in the identification and acquisition of resources, as well as the ongoing management of information resources and library collections. You will have the opportunity to provide an excellent service to our users and have a positive impact on their journey as well as supporting researchers to make their research outputs as visible and openly available as possible.

The key responsibilities include:

  • Discovering, selecting, acquiring and providing access to library resources needed for teaching, learning and research;
  • Providing first-line Library and IT help, advice and problem solving through all communication channels,including in person, phone and online;
  • Assisting with projects and the development of services to support customer needs.

Skills, Experience & Qualification needed

  • We are looking for candidates who can demonstrate excellent interpersonal skills and a strong customer service ethos, combined with the ability to troubleshoot problems and use your initiative.
  • You will have the ability to work effectively with colleagues in a variety of contexts. You will be able to organise your own work and coordinate with others to achieve tasks allocated either to you or your team, to the required deadlines or service delivery standards.
  • You will be able to use and learn a range of systems, software and equipment (for example library systems, IT packages, digitisation equipment) to carry out administrative processes. Attention to detail and efficiency is essential.
  • You will have a good standard of education to GCSE/NVQ1 level (or equivalent) or relevant experience. Experience of working in an archive, library or museum service is desirable but not essential.
  • You will be flexible, adaptable and convey a positive attitude.
